From capacity considerations to recharge times and expandability, each element influences how well a system will serve you in real-world scenarios.Capacity and Expandability
When choosing a solar generator, consider both the current capacity and how much you might need in the future. Systems like the BLUETTI AC200L offer large initial capacities with multiple expansion modules, suitable for long-term backup or heavy power needs. Keep in mind that larger capacities often mean increased size and cost, so balance your immediate needs with potential growth. An expandable system can save money over time, but ensure the expansion modules are compatible and easy to add when needed.

Build Quality and Durability
High-quality batteries and rugged construction are key for longevity, especially if you plan to use your generator frequently or in rough environments. LiFePO4 batteries, used in many top models, offer longer cycle life and better thermal stability compared to older lithium-ion chemistries. Consider the manufacturer’s warranty and whether the design includes features like weather resistance or shock absorption, which can extend the lifespan of your investment.

Can I expand my solar generator with any type of battery?
Not all expansion batteries are compatible with every solar generator. Many brands design their systems with specific modules that fit seamlessly, ensuring safety and performance. Always check the manufacturer’s specifications to confirm compatibility before purchasing additional batteries. Using incompatible batteries can lead to issues like uneven charging, reduced lifespan, or safety hazards. When expanding, sticking to official or recommended modules is the safest approach.
How does the capacity of the expansion battery affect overall run time?
The capacity of an expansion battery directly influences how long your power station can run devices. For example, adding a 1024Wh expansion to a 2048Wh base unit effectively doubles your available energy, allowing longer operation periods. However, actual run time also depends on the load—higher power devices drain the battery faster. Be sure to estimate your typical power consumption to select an appropriate expansion size that meets your needs without overpaying for unused capacity.

What are the main differences between LiFePO4 and traditional lithium-ion batteries?
LiFePO4 batteries offer longer cycle life, greater thermal stability, and improved safety compared to standard lithium-ion batteries. These advantages make them ideal for frequent use and extended deployments, especially when combined with expansion modules. They also retain capacity better over time, ensuring your system remains reliable. The main tradeoff is that LiFePO4 systems tend to be heavier and more expensive initially, but they usually provide better value over the long run due to their durability.
How do I determine the right capacity for my backup power needs?
To select the right capacity, list the essential devices you want to run and their power consumption, then estimate how long you’ll need them powered during an outage. For instance, if you need to run a refrigerator (around 150W) for 24 hours, you’ll need roughly 3,600Wh of capacity. Always add a buffer for efficiency losses and future needs. Matching your capacity to realistic usage patterns helps prevent overspending and ensures reliable backup when needed most.
